    • Electric vehicle sales increase in China; Overall automobile transactions fall; New Year holiday affects output New electric vehicle (EV) sales in China bucked overall lower automobile transactions to jump month-on-month (m-o-m) in February, according to data from the Ministry of Industry and Information Technology (MIIT), released in March.

      EV sales more than doubled to 14,000 units in February, compared with 5,700 units in January, MIIT data showed.

      EV production in February also soared to 15,000 units, more than double January's 6,900 units.

      As a result of the two-week Chinese New Year holiday in early February, the overall automobile output fell by nearly 9% m-o-m to 2.16m units, while sales declined 23% m-o-m to 1.94m units.

      As a result of favourable government policy to promote EVs in China, EV sales - a key driver in lithium-ion battery minerals prices - are widely expected to increase during 2017.
